    About this product

    Seedance 2.5 AI Video Generator is an AI video model that generates native 30-second scenes, supports video continuation, multimodal references, and precise editing. It takes text prompts or image/video references as input and outputs video clips up to 30 seconds in length, with options for aspect ratio (16:9 shown), duration (4s shown), and resolution (480p shown). The model is designed by the Seedance team.

    What is Seedance 2.5?

    Seedance 2.5 is an AI video model for generating complete scenes up to 30 seconds natively in a single segment, with room for camera movement, scene changes, and a clear beginning-to-end story. It accepts text prompts and optional image or video references to guide subject, composition, motion, and style. The model also offers video continuation (extending existing clips) and targeted video editing without full regeneration.

    Key Features

    • Native 30-Second Generation — Creates a single continuous 30-second video scene with room for camera movement, scene transitions, and a clear beginning-to-end story.
    • Multimodal Understanding — Interprets characters, products, environments, motion, and visual style from uploaded images or videos to guide consistent AI video output.
    • Precise Video Editing — Allows targeted refinement of specific details (e.g., changing an object) while preserving the surrounding scene, visual style, and subject consistency.
    • Video Continuation — Extends generated videos by preserving subjects, environments, lighting, movement, and composition across additional segments.
    • Text-to-Video & Image-to-Video — Accepts either a text prompt alone or combined with image/video references to control the output.
    • Workflow Integration — Connects generation, continuation, and editing in one process, with steps for uploading references, writing prompts, and reviewing results.

    Who is it for?

    • Content creators — Social media video production, product demos, and short-form storytelling.
    • Marketers and advertisers — Creating promotional videos, product reveals, and campaign concepts with controlled visual direction.
    • Filmmakers and previsualization artists — Testing camera blocking, spatial transitions, and story rhythm before full production.
    • Architects and designers — Visualizing interiors, buildings, and spatial concepts with controlled camera paths and scene transitions.

    Use Cases

    • Advertising and Marketing Videos — Produce product reveals, campaign concepts, and social ads with a clear hook and visual progression.
    • Social Media Video Creation — Turn ideas and images into short stories, tutorials, announcements, and creator-focused content in vertical or widescreen formats.
    • Educational and Science Videos — Turn explanations, diagrams, and scientific concepts into clear visual sequences using reference-guided scenes.
    • E-Commerce Product Showcases — Create product videos from images, packaging, and usage concepts while keeping visuals consistent.
    • Film and Story Previsualization — Explore camera blocking, ensemble scenes, and visual atmosphere before full production.

    How does it work?

    The workflow has three steps: (1) Upload supported image or video references to guide subject, composition, motion, and style. (2) Write a prompt describing subject, action, camera movement, visual style, and pacing. (3) Review selected model (e.g., Seedance 2.0 Mini) and settings (aspect ratio, duration, resolution), then generate the video.
